    Default SES offers to help Romania

    Published: 11.30 Europe/London, May 11, 2011 by Chris Dziadul
    SES Astra is interested in supporting and participating in Romania’s transition to digital broadcasting, according to Martin Ornass-Kubacki, VP and chief regional officer, Astra CEE.
    Speaking in a conference in Bucharest entitled Romania in High Definition organised by the Association of Digital Communications (ACD) and quoted by ZF, he added that Romania could have problems in the transition process if it only viewed things from the perspective of terrestrial TV signal distribution.
    In Astra’s view, Romania will have over 50 HD channels by 2015, with more than 4 million homes receiving HD services and satellite the main means for their distribution.
    He added that satellite should be seen as complementing rather than competing DTT.
    Romania now expects to complete the transition to digital broadcasting in 2013.
